1. This is background information for your remarks to the Security
Affairs Support Association (BABA) Spring '88 Symposium on Saturday, 16 April
9:U0 - 9:35 a.rn. at our Headquarters Auditorium.
2. Arrangements: Evan Hineman will meet you in your office at 8:50 a. m.
and escort you to the auditorium. President of SASA John McMahon will give
opening remarks at 9:U0 a.m. Your address on "The Intelligence Environment of
the '9U's" is scheduled to begin at 9:U5 a.m. and John McMahon will introduce
you. The suggested format is 25 minutes of remarks and a question and answer
period is not scheduled. Your participation in the program is over at
9:30 a.m., but you are invited to attend any of the following sessions. (For
complete agenda see opposite.) Auditorium technicians will tape your remarks
for the Agency's historical records. An Agency photographer will be taking
photographs.
Approximately 40U attendees including senior and middle management
executives from the aerospace -and electronics industries who are involved in
classified programs for the Intelligence Community will attend. Companies
such as Cray Research, Hughes Aircraft, Lockheed, and Boeing will be
represented. (See list of companies opposite.) Senior government officials
from the Intelligence Corrnnunity will make up about 10 percent of the
audience. (See guest list opposite.) All attendees have TS/SI/TK clearances.
3. About SASA: The mission of SASA is to "enhance the relationships and
understanding among those in government, industry and academe who are involved
in and concerned with the well-being and success of the national intelligence
endeavor." Founded in 1979 and chartered as a professional association by the
State of Maryland, SASA highlights issues of interest to government and
industry alike in their programs. You addressed the SASA group at their West
Coast Symposium on "Software Trends in the Intelligence Community" in
